I just thought I would give an update to let you know that 7 years after starting an IVA I have finally received my completion certificate!

The first 6 years were not too bad but this last one has been a bit of a roller coaster.

I have had my battles with Cleardebt for the last year and it has been very confrontational by both parties.

That said, when we did finally agree on a resolution, I cannot fault David Mond for personally keeping me updated on each step of the closure process.

The only advice I would offer to him and any IVA company for that matter is:
1. Don’t say you are going to do something and then not deliver. (I was told in February 2012 by Jayne Brown of Cleardebt that my Completion Certificate would be with me within a month or two)
2. If a client does not agree with you then using the “NUCLEAR” option should be the last tool in the bag and not the first. I refer to “Sign this or I will make you Bankrupt”

I am not one for holding a grudge so will take this opportunity to wish David and his team at ClearDebt all the best for the future.

My thoughts are very much with those with other companies still waiting for their cases to be closed!
